Output 08d5643aaa1bfbdb41af692f77a026cb6f6be625aedbfb33435ea8e14d165c68:0

value
821492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79b1c0133f7c288f835734ef85c3edc827ce43e3 OP_EQUAL
address
3CnUd4ZM7EYWef5j4KDow2SjdufkZpSVSN
transaction
08d5643aaa1bfbdb41af692f77a026cb6f6be625aedbfb33435ea8e14d165c68
confirmations
257931
spent
true